You are likely suffering from insomnia.

Insomnia (sleep disturbance) is of two types:

1. Primary: There is problem of only sleep disturbance and no other physical or psychological problem is there. In this case treatment for sleep problem is needed.

2. Secondary: There is some underlying physical or psychological problem which is responsible for sleep disturbance. In this main treatment is done for underlying problem.
